Cofferdam water retaining structure for beach bridge foundation construction and construction method
The invention relates to a cofferdam water-retaining structure for beach bridge foundation construction and a construction method, and the cofferdam water-retaining structure comprises a water-retaining cofferdam which comprises a ground water-retaining section and an underground insertion section; the soil retaining cofferdam is arranged in the water retaining cofferdam and comprises a ground soil retaining section and an underground soil retaining section, and a mounting space is formed between the ground soil retaining section and the ground water retaining section; and the interlayer platform is arranged in the mounting space. The interlayer platform is used as an internal support of the water retaining cofferdam, the interlayer platform and the water retaining cofferdam jointly resist the water head pressure at the high water level, and meanwhile the interlayer platform is used as a ground foundation and a mechanical operation platform during soil retaining cofferdam construction; therefore, the interlayer platform is used as a mechanical construction channel, the bored pile foundation and the soil retaining cofferdam are constructed, then bearing platform construction can be carried out after precipitation, the consumption of a bored platform structure and bottom sealing concrete in the bored pile construction period is saved in the construction process, overwater construction is changed into land construction, and construction is more convenient and faster.
